In addition to the powers and duties of the director as specified by Section 13-1-1330, when it shall appear that the acquisition, by purchase, construction, condemnation or donation, and operation of additional connecting, switching, terminal or other railroads are desirable in the public interest to promote and foster economic growth and development, the director may, with the approval of the State Fiscal Accountability Authority, extend the division's operations, provided, that if such extension includes extension of mainline trackage, the common carrier railroads operating in the State shall have declined to agree to provide such facilities within six months after having been requested to do so by the division and the State Fiscal Accountability Authority and provided the financing for such extensions is approved by the State Fiscal Accountability Authority pursuant to the provisions of this article.
S.C. Code Ann. § 13-1-1350
Power of director to extend division's operations
1993 Act No. 181, SECTION 247, eff July 1, 1993.
